### Release Checklist — Image Slimming (Tarnwell Shipper)

Confirm the slimmed base image passed the size gate: final layer must be under 180 MB. Verify the stripped debug symbols were archived to the Vexhall symbol store before deletion. Smoke-test the container locally with the minimal entrypoint; missing shared libraries usually surface here. Once all three checks pass, mark this item done and quote the build token printed below.

trace token, tawep-fahif: htk3_b58

# Pagination constants for the Lanternbay public REST API.
#
# All list endpoints use opaque cursors, not offsets. Clients may request
# a page size, but the server clamps it to the configured maximum and
# never errors on oversized requests — this is intentional, so don't
# "fix" it. The defaults were chosen after the Marrowfield load tests
# showed latency climbing sharply past 200 items per page. If you change
# anything here, update the public docs in the same commit. Current
# values are as follows.

tuning table, yajog-yahof:
BUDGETS = {
    "lamvan": 303,
    "wenox": 460,
    "fenvan": 525,
}

Changed defaults in Splitfork, our assignment service. Bucketing now uses sticky hashing per account instead of per session, and the holdout slice grew from 2% to 5%. Callers relying on session-level reassignment must opt in explicitly. Review the diff against the new baseline; the updated default configuration is listed below.

config for tagep-kajof:
[casir]
port = 6379
region = south-1
host = casir.paliqdyn.example
team = tamax
timeout_ms = 250
retries = 2